Wednesday, 25-February-2009
Almotamar.net - Yemen parliament decided Wednesday to hold an extraordinary meeting Thursday under the demand of more than 120 MPs from parliamentary blocs of the General People’s Congress GPC, Joint Meeting Parties JMP and the independent. The extraordinary session is to be devoted to demand of amending article 65 of the Yemeni constitution related to defining the parliament term for six years. The reason for enabling to extending for two additional years for the present parliament supposed to hold elections for selecting new MPs on the 27th of next April.

The MPs, whose number exceeds the legally required third of the number for calling to extension, justified that for allowing the opportunity to the political parties and civil society organisations to discuss introduction of constitutional amendments necessary for development of the political and electoral, including the proportionate representation systems. The aim is also to enable the parties represented in the parliament to complete the subjects unfinished during the period for preparing amendments on the elections law before 18 of last August and to include what would be agreed on in the body of the law, in addition to re-formation of the supreme commission for elections.

According to legal measures, the demand for amending articles in the constitution it is necessary to secure acceptance of two thirds of the parliament members and after that, the subject is referred to the concerned committee to study the demand within two months time, i.e. on 26 of next April.
